Taking over from Darvin. Summary for review:

Bug: client drops websocket after idle ~90s; reconnect loop fires before token refresh, causing 401 storms. Fix in branch relay/reconnect-backoff adds jittered backoff and gates reconnect on refreshed session.

Tested against staging cluster (Norvale region). Load test passed; no regression in heartbeat path.

Remaining: reviewer sign-off on backoff constants, then tag v4.2.1 and cut the release build.

Deploy is blocked until signing is done. Use the release signing key below.

deploy key for kajof-fajop: bky6_gDHw9Q

// MAX_GATE_PULSES_PER_SEC caps how many turnstile pulses the Harrowgate
// counter accepts from a single gate before flagging it as jittery.
// Field data from the Delmore Arena pilot showed real throughput never
// exceeds 3/sec; anything higher is sensor bounce. Raising this requires
// sign-off at the eng sync. Calibration firmware is pinned to the token below.

trace token, kahog-tajeg: htk6_97d963

# Environments: Harbormark Gateway

All three environments sit behind the Brightquay load balancer. Health checks hit the shallow endpoint every five seconds; two consecutive failures pull a node. Staging mirrors prod checks exactly — don't loosen them. Release manager signs off before any threshold change. Each environment applies the following configuration.

config for tagep-yajef:
ulawyn:
  log_level: error
  metrics_host: metrics.ulawyn.lumiclabs.internal
  pin: 0564
  pool_size: 32

Subject: Reccoon cut-over — done!

Hi all — the inventory reconciliation job is now fully on the new Thornby scheduler as of last night. Old cron entries on the legacy box are disabled, not deleted, in case we need a quick fallback. First run completed clean with zero mismatches. For reference, here's the configuration the job is now running with.

config for yajep-tafof:
[rusath]
team = julmir
access_code = ac_fe37fd
host = rusath.novactech.test
port = 8000
owner = pelmir.weneth
peer = oliwyn.olvarqdyn.internal